STRUCTURE OF THE HIV-1 NUCLEOCAPSID PROTEIN BOUND TO THE SL3 PSI-RNA RECOGNITION ELEMENT, NMR, 25 STRUCTURES

About this Structure

1A1T is a Single protein structure of sequence from Human immunodeficiency virus 1. Additional information on 1A1T is available in a page on Zinc Fingers at the RCSB PDB Molecule of the Month. Full experimental information is available from OCA.

Reference

Structure of the HIV-1 nucleocapsid protein bound to the SL3 psi-RNA recognition element., De Guzman RN, Wu ZR, Stalling CC, Pappalardo L, Borer PN, Summers MF, Science. 1998 Jan 16;279(5349):384-8. PMID:9430589
